Speak the Language of Your Audience: Optimizing for Voice Search

Traditional SEO focuses on keywords people type into search engines. Voice search optimization, however, requires a different approach. Here’s how to ensure your website is voice search friendly:

Target long-tail keywords. People speak in full sentences with natural language, not short keywords.  Think “best restaurants near me with outdoor seating” instead of just “restaurants.” Focus on conversational language. Optimize your content for the way people speak, using questions and natural phrasing. Prioritize Local SEO. Voice search is often used for local queries like “best bakery nearby.” Ensure your local listings are accurate and optimized.

Optimize for Mobile. Most voice searches happen on smartphones. Ensure your website is mobile-friendly and loads quickly. Focus on creating content that directly answers user questions and provides valuable information.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: What is voice search optimization?

Ans: Voice search optimization involves tailoring your website’s content and SEO strategies to accommodate voice search queries. This means focusing on natural language, long-tail keywords, and concise answers to common questions.

Q2: Why is voice search important for SEO?

Ans: Voice search is increasingly popular as more people use devices like smartphones and smart speakers. Optimizing for voice search can help your content rank higher in search results, improve user experience, and drive more organic traffic to your site.

Q3: What types of content are best for voice search optimization?

Ans: Content that directly answers questions, such as FAQs, how-to guides, and concise informational articles, is ideal for voice search optimization. Using a conversational tone and addressing the user’s intent can also improve your chances of ranking in voice search results.

Q4: How does voice search differ from traditional text search?

Ans: Voice search differs from traditional text search in that it uses natural, conversational language and is often phrased as a question. Voice searches tend to be longer and more specific, focusing on immediate, actionable information.

Q5: Can local businesses benefit from voice search optimization?

Ans: Yes, local businesses can greatly benefit from voice search optimization. Many voice searches are location-based, such as “near me” queries. Ensuring your business information is up-to-date on local directories and using location-specific keywords can help attract local customers through voice search.
